What Is an Air Curtain?
An air curtain is a device installed above a doorway that blows a controlled stream of air downward. This invisible barrier helps separate indoor and outdoor environments without using a physical door.
Youโll often see them at:
shop entrances
malls and hospitals
restaurants and commercial buildings
warehouses and industrial units
Why Air Curtains Are Useful in Mumbai
Mumbai has some unique challengesโhigh humidity, dust, pollution, insects, and constant foot traffic. In such conditions, traditional doors are often kept open, which creates problems.
This is where air curtain in Mumbai installations really help.
Air curtains are commonly used here because they:
reduce hot and humid air entering indoors
keep dust and pollution outside
prevent insects from coming in
maintain indoor cooling efficiency
allow smooth movement without closing doors

Things to Keep in Mind
Air curtains are helpful, but they work best when:
sized correctly for the doorway
installed at the right height
maintained periodically
used in suitable locations
They donโt replace doors, but they reduce the need to keep doors closed all the time.
